Taylor Hospital was my hospital. What now?

Taylor closed in 2025 under Crozer's restructuring. Your plan's nearest in-network option is now likely Mercy Fitzgerald, Riddle, or Crozer-Chester depending on your address and plan. This kind of change can sometimes trigger a Special Enrollment Period. We can check whether you qualify.

Which is the closest hospital from Folsom now?

Depends on your specific street. For most of Folsom, Mercy Fitzgerald in Darby and Crozer-Chester in Upland are roughly comparable in drive. Riddle in the Media area is a bit further west.

Should I enroll in Medicare Supplement or Medicare Advantage?

Honest answer. . . it depends on three things.

First, your providers. Medicare Supplement (Medigap) lets you see any provider in the country who accepts Medicare. No network. Medicare Advantage uses a defined network.

Second, your tolerance for variable costs. Medigap has a higher monthly premium but very predictable copays. Medicare Advantage usually has a low or $0 monthly premium but variable copays and coinsurance.

Third, your prescriptions. Medigap requires a separate Part D plan. Most Medicare Advantage plans bundle drug coverage in.

Is there a way to help reduce or cover costs of Medicare Advantage co-payments and co-insurance?

Sometimes, yes. Hospital indemnity insurance is one tool worth knowing about.

It's a separate insurance product. Not a Medicare benefit, not a replacement for Medicare, not major medical. It pays you a fixed cash amount per qualifying event. . . hospital admission, ER visit, ambulance ride, ICU stay.

You decide how to use the cash.
